
Through Fix - TFS1
For facades where an element of adjustment is required an Eltherington through-fix rainscreen cladding system is the best choice. Our through fix system offers an adjustable void depth and is therefore able to accommodate a range of insulation thicknesses, whilst overcoming any irregularities in the substrate.
That makes the rainscreen cladding solution ideal where the variances in quality of infill material on existing buildings dictate that fixings can only be secured at certain points across the facade, for example, at floor slabs.
Eltherington through-fix systems are designed so that the fixings are minimally visible across the facade, being masked by the shadow-lines between the panels. From a distance, this maintains the sheer, architectural appearance of the facade.

Specification
• Material - Aluminium, Steel
• Finish - PPC, Pre-paint, Anodised, Corten, Rimex
• Thickness - 2 / 3 / 4mm
• Panel size - 1480 x 3850mm max
• Horizontal joint - 20mm
• Fixings - Self drill mechanical fixings
• Rail centres - 600mm max
• Install method - 1st & 2nd fix layout
• CWCT tested with Hilti-Eurofox
• Fire Rating (Panel) - A1 & A2 available
